Calories in Classic White Organic White Bread

📏 Serving Size: 1 Serving (28.0g)

🧪 Nutrition Facts

Amount Per Serving
  • Calories 70.0
  • Total Fat 0.0 g
  • Saturated Fat 0.0 g
  • Cholesterol 0.0 mg
  • Sodium 115.1 mg
  • Potassium 0.0 mg
  • Total Carbohydrate 13.0 g
  • Dietary Fiber 1.0 g
  • Sugars 2.0 g
  • Protein 3.0 g

📝 Ingredients

Organic Wheat Flour, Water, Organic Sugar, Organic Wheat Gluten Yeast, Contains 2 Percent or Less of: Organic Sunflower Oil, Sea Salt, Organic Whole Wheat Flour, Organic Vinegar, Cultured Organic Wheat Flour, Ascorbic Acid, Enzymes.

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Classic White Organic White Bread

Is Classic White Organic White Bread good for weight loss?

White bread is calorie-dense and low in fiber, making it less ideal for weight loss as it won't keep you full long. The refined carbs can spike blood sugar and increase hunger cravings shortly after eating.

Is Classic White Organic White Bread good for muscle building?

Each slice provides 3g of protein, which is modest but helpful when combined with other protein sources throughout the day. However, it's better paired with higher-protein foods like eggs, yogurt, or lean meats for effective muscle building.

What diets does Classic White Organic White Bread suit?

This bread works well with most diets including omnivore, vegan, and vegetarian plans. It's not suitable for low-carb, keto, or gluten-free diets due to its carb content and wheat ingredients.

What should I watch out for with Classic White Organic White Bread?

The bread contains added sugar (2g per slice) which can add up if you eat multiple slices daily. Since it's made with refined wheat flour rather than whole grain, it lacks the sustained energy and satiety benefits of whole wheat varieties.

How does Classic White Organic White Bread fit into a balanced diet?

White bread can be part of a balanced diet as a carbohydrate source, but limit it to 1-2 slices per meal and pair it with protein and healthy fats. Choosing whole grain bread more often would provide better nutrition and fiber for overall health.
